Izmo has commenced production shipments of an indigenous 40 GHz RF semiconductor package designed for defense and secure communication systems. The development marks a significant step in the company's product portfolio expansion.

Technical Specifications
The package is a high-frequency RF Quad Flat No-Lead (QFN) device developed by izmo Microsystems Pvt. Ltd. It features a proprietary architecture with optimized trace geometry and die positioning. This design achieves wire bond lengths of approximately 0.3 mm and includes a precision air cavity surrounding the die to minimize parasitic effects.
Strategic Context
The move aligns with India’s Semicon 2.0 program, which has an outlay of ₹1,27,500 crore. Strengthening the ATMP/OSAT industry is one of the program’s six pillars. Izmo positions itself in segments that typically demand rigorous certification and offer higher margins compared to consumer electronics.
